Fiat 500 Key Fob Replacement

If your 500 key fob doesn't work Try another one to see if your car will recognize it. If it does, the problem is probably due to the battery or water damage on the original fob.

Replace the battery first. Make sure that the new #CR2032 coin battery is inserted correctly, with the "+" side facing downwards in the fob.

Dead Battery

The majority of the time, when a fob doesn't work, it's because the battery is dead. This is easy to fix and most fobs will give you a warning when the battery is dying. There are instructions on YouTube for almost any key fob for your car, or in the owner's manual. You can also take it to a local locksmith or to the dealer who supplied it to you to repair it.

Water Damage

Water damage is likely to happen on your device, whether you dropped them in the pool accidentally or left them in the pocket while swimming, or splashed water on them during a rainy afternoon. Even if it's just an ounce of water on the key, it can cause serious problems with its electronic components.

It is usually possible to fix this issue by taking the fob out and cleaning it using a paper towel. Once the fob has dried, you can replace its battery. It will then begin working properly.
